On April 21, Beijing time, the NBA playoffs continued. The Nets lost again, trailing 0-2 in the series, and although the Nets had the hope of turning the tables, the probability was already low. According to the big data prediction of the well-known data agency FiveThirtyEight, the chance of the Green Army reaching the Eastern Conference semifinals is 94%, while the Nets are only 6%. In the G2 game, Irving and Durant pulled their crotches at the same time, which is really rare!

While we regret for the Nets, we also have to praise the Green Army, Tatum, Brown, Tatum and Horford can really do something big, strong defense, sharp offensive coordination, tacit understanding and chemistry is excellent. What about the Nets side? Not only is the dual-core play sluggish, Nash is also helpless, watching the Green Army complete a 17-point reversal. Owen 40 points revenge

Back at the Barclays center with a 0-2 disadvantage, the Nets had to pick themselves up and not be passive. In the face of the strong and menacing Green Army, if the Nets want to win, Irving must stand up. In the G2 game, Irving played 40 minutes and 20 seconds, only 4 of 13 shots, only 10 points, 8 rebounds, 1 assist and 2 turnovers, plus or minus -9. How could such An Irving lead the team to victory? At home to the Greens, where he once played, Irving failed to prove himself.

However, back at home, Irving must help Durant share the pressure. In the G1 game, Irving frantically scored 39 points and almost beat the Green Army. Therefore, Irving must score 40 points in the G3 game, which is the bottom line and guarantee to defeat the Green Army. Another point, due to Irving's sluggish offensive status, opponents began to frantically pack Durant, resulting in the Nets' entire team's offensive paralysis.

Owen wants to complete the revenge, can not only rely on words, but also need to be proved by practical actions. After the first game, Irving was fined $50,000 for giving the fans a middle finger.

Du Shao incarnated as a master passer

Unlike Irving's situation, It's very difficult for Kevin Durant to score. In the G2 game, it can be seen that the Green Army will frantically wrap Durant, and it is a double defense, and it will not find the opportunity to shoot. The end result? Played 43 minutes, 4 of 17 shooting, 18 of 20 free throws, only 27 points, 4 rebounds, 5 assists, 6 turnovers and 5 fouls, plus or minus -10. Since this defensive strategy works, the Green Army will stick to it, and Durant will have a hard time scoring the next game, but he can become a passing master and pass the ball without thinking about scoring.

Durant is tall and arm-length, and has a strong ability to break through, which can attract the opponent's defensive attention and then pass the ball to his teammates. The Nets have multiple shooters, with Seth Curry and Mills both big heart shooters. Irving scores, Durant passes, such an arrangement is the most reasonable, is the key to defending the home field.

0-3 forced out the Nets bottom card

G3 is a life-and-death battle for the Nets, once the game is lost at home, the big score is 0-3, and it is difficult to turn the tables at this time. However, it is the current predicament that has forced the Nets to play the bottom card, and Ben Simmons, who has not played a game this season, is expected to return and share the pressure for Irving and Durant. Just today, Nash said: "Unless Simmons himself says, 'I'm ready,' we're not going to force him to come back." However, Fameworth reports: Sources told that Simmons is targeting a first-round G4 comeback.

What about Bency, who hasn't played in a season? Can you help the team? These are all unknowns. But the Nets are at stake, and Bency needs to show his attitude.
